The Heroine has appeared in Praya right after... yet another jump through time and space. That's the reason why she is able to use only one ultimate ability at the moment, but, on the other hand, she can already make some noise on the battlefield with 2 class talent upgrades!
This Heroine is famous both for her mischievous temper and her virtuous time bending abilities. In her hands, time can flow faster or slower, it can stop or run backwards!
Chronicle is effective both as a caster and an auto-attacker — you shall decide, who do you want for her to become.

The Curse of TimeChronicle’s passive ability works every time an enemy Hero near her gets stunned. The enemy Hero will receive damage, and the Heroine herself will get a Speed boost for a while. This ability will also provide Chronicle a Health Regeneration boost. Any stun effect triggers the skill — it doesn’t matter if it comes from the Heroine or from any of her allies, if it is class ability or not. So, in team fights, especially at the late phase of the game, Chronicle will make any stun more effective with her passive ability. This makes her a desired teammate for such Heroes as Rat Master, Plague Doctor, Rumbler and others, who are capable of stunning enemies.

Fleeting ImpulseHeroine’s second passive ability will not leave any auto-attacking Heroes lover indifferent. Once in a few auto-attacks, Chronicle will stun her victim for a short while. |
With a decent skill, you will be able to hit an enemy Hero with a stunning attack — and, thanks to the passive ability, it will allow Chronicle to effectively deal with any issue on a line.

Time must go onAre you ready for the past to come back? This active ability will allow the Heroine to turn back time. The ability can be used only on the Heroine herself or her enemies. After a few seconds, the target will get back to the point where it has been standing at the time the ability has been used. Learning the talent’s upgrade will also make it possible to turn back Health and Energy. Of course, only if they were on a lower rate before the time warp for the enemies, and on a higher rate for Chronicle. |
If the talent is used while standing on the Native Terrain, Chronicle will receive an additional bonus to Agility.

Aegis of TimeThird Chronicle’s passive ability is made to help the Heroine feel a little more protected. If Chronicle gets stunned, she will receive a damage absorption boost for a while. This will help her survive enemy ganks. |
However, please consider that the ability has a decent cooldown

Time AnomalyHeroine’s main ultimate will suit team play and emphasize caster’s build efficiency. |
Upon use, the ultimate creates an area, inside which all enemies will receive a stun effect once in a while. If upgraded, this ability will also slow the enemies inside the area down.
